No active FMCSA cargo filing on file.
FMCSA L&I filing evidence — not a shipper certificate of insurance (COI). Cargo (BMC-34) is primarily an HHG / household-goods requirement; general freight carriers often have none.
No active broker surety bond or trust fund on file.
BMC-84 is a surety bond; BMC-85 is a trust-fund agreement. Required for property brokers / freight forwarders — not motor-carrier BIPD liability insurance.

Carrier analysis & narrative context Status notes, risk intelligence, and safety profiles
Carrier is unrated
FMCSA has not assigned this carrier a formal safety rating. Use the inspection history and BASIC scores below to assess on-road performance.
MEX TRUCKING INC had 8 roadside inspections over the past 24 months with an out-of-service rate of 25.0%, which is above the national average of 19.3%. Their highest FMCSA BASIC percentile is Unsafe Driving at 12.0. 1 reportable crash occurred in the same 24-month window.
8 roadside inspections over the last 24 months, concentrated in IN (7) and MI (1).
25.0% out-of-service rate, above the 19.3% national average; led by Vehicle Maintenance (21.4% of violations); top code 392.2 (Violation of Local Laws) cited 1 times.
The fleet comprises 6 power units (small fleet) and 6 drivers; Volvo, Mack, and Unknown are the most-inspected makes.

Authority Records (above) are FMCSA docket status and lifecycle events. MC Certificate Documents here are the archived PDF letters for each action — grants, reinstatements, revocations, name changes, and transfers. They are related but not the same dataset: one row per PDF letter, not one file per docket.
Each row is a distinct FMCSA letter (grant, reinstatement, revocation, name change, transfer, etc.). When a PDF is archived, click the link to open that letter.
